Former Auburn standout Daniel Thomas makes fast return to NFL

The Jacksonville Jaguars re-signed Daniel Thomas to a two-year contract final offseason to maintain the protection out of NFL free company. However after Thomas’ fifth season with the Jaguars, Jacksonville launched the previous Auburn standout on Tuesday when it diminished its preseason roster to the regular-season restrict of 53 gamers.

Thomas wasn’t out of the NFL for lengthy. On Wednesday, the Detroit Lions introduced they’d signed the protection for his or her energetic roster.

Throughout 71 regular-season video games – probably the most by an Auburn participant in a Jaguars uniform – and two playoff video games, Thomas has developed into one of many NFL’s most energetic special-teams gamers.

With Jacksonville, Thomas was on the sphere for 445 defensive snaps and 1,208 special-teams performs. Throughout his rookie season, Thomas blocked a punt by the Los Angeles Chargers’ Ty Lengthy, then recovered the free soccer and returned it 16 yards for a landing on Oct. 25, 2020.

Detroit is lacking three of the seven gamers who had at the very least 210 special-teams performs for the Lions in 2024.

Earlier than Auburn and the NFL, Thomas was a prep standout at Lee-Montgomery (now named Percy Julian).

Phrases of Thomas’ contract with the Lions haven’t been reported.
